Tour guide was very knowledgable and willing to answer questions. The Vatican was extremely busy so I would recommend booking this tour! The tour lasted around 3 hours which was plenty of time to see all the beautiful sights. So glad I booked this tour!

So we're off to Rome for our 30th Wedding Anniversary;- nearly 4 years overdue; after the last attempt being cancelled due to the "Ash Cloud". Some things are not meant to be. So should we let this trip lie? No! December may not be everyone's choice for visiting Rome, but what a pleasure it was;- to enjoy the winter sunshine, to still eat out in the open at night, to avoid the crowds, to soak up the atmosphere. Need I say more? Our main aim was to see the Vatican, St.Peter's Basilica and the Sistine Chapel. To save time we booked through "AttractionTix" for a No Wait Access Vatican Tour. It couldn't of been better. We were met by our Tour Guide -Chris, who escorted us through to gain our necessary tickets and entrance, without fuss or hassle. It was difficult to believe that this young man could be so enthusiastic and full of energy, as though he lived and breathed every moment in every fact he told us. Are croissants really "moon shaped" so that the King of Poland could eat his enemy the Turks?( the crescent shape on their National Flag). Did Michelangelo really never take his boots off and show his feet? All these anecdotes humorously told within all the many facts;- ensuring that the group was still awake and attentive. The beauty in the Vatican cannot be put on paper. It has to be experienced for oneself. The Sistine Chapel and St.Peter's Basilica are magnificent, but my own favourite was 'The Map Gallery' ,in the Papal apartments. Why? I'm not telling you;- you'll have to go and see for yourself. We left the Vatican, with our 3 coins for the Trevi Fountain Si the trip was splendid! Si we will return!
